Super Chain Crusher Horizon is an indie shooter built around ultra widescreen chaos. You fire rapid bursts across a 3200x800 battlefield, linking small explosions into cascading chain reactions. The main goal is filling a 2000-pixel charge gauge to trigger a single massive shot that spans the entire screen. Single-player levels cycle through basic wave defense and objective-based missions while multiplayer modes focus on competitive chain attacks and gauge racing. The game’s wild use of screen space sets it apart. Players often note how the 2000-pixel explosion feels genuinely massive when properly charged. Though not complex, the rhythm of building and releasing chains has a satisfying loop. Casual players on forums mention averaging 8, 10 hours to max out the gauge mechanics, with some returning for the visual spectacle alone.
